Output 3f7cc89e59ee6ef76df8e5a6cd0e11f56cef90f77d4ba141d5ebb9f0b101ac2f:1

value
389208
script pubkey
OP_0 OP_PUSHBYTES_20 b8a5dfa705fd43ffac30e0e44b861f343a77d6c5
address
bc1qhzjalfc9l4plltpsurjyhpslxsa804k9df5ass
transaction
3f7cc89e59ee6ef76df8e5a6cd0e11f56cef90f77d4ba141d5ebb9f0b101ac2f